The main differences between ordinary aluminum-plated film and aluminum-plated film with primer are as follows:

Surface properties

• Ordinary aluminum-plated film: The surface is relatively smooth, the aluminum layer is directly exposed, the affinity with other materials is poor, and the surface energy is relatively low.

• Aluminum-plated film with primer: Due to the presence of primer, the surface roughness and surface energy are improved, which can better combine with other substances, providing a better foundation for subsequent printing, lamination and other processing.

Adhesion

• Ordinary aluminum-plated film: The aluminum layer and the substrate are mainly physically attached. When affected by external forces or environmental factors, the aluminum layer is prone to shedding and peeling.

• Aluminum-plated film with primer: The primer acts as a bridge between the aluminum layer and the substrate. Through chemical bonding or physical adsorption, it greatly improves the adhesion between the aluminum layer and the substrate, making the aluminum film more durable.

Printing performance

• Ordinary aluminized film: When printing directly on its surface, the ink adhesion is poor, and the printed pattern is prone to blurring and fading, which requires high printing technology and ink.

• Primer-coated aluminized film: The primer can improve the printability of the surface, so that the ink can better adhere to the aluminized film, the printed pattern is clearer, firmer, and colorful, and can withstand certain friction and scratches.

Chemical resistance

• Ordinary aluminized film: The aluminum layer is easily corroded by some chemicals. When it comes into contact with acids, alkalis, organic solvents, etc., chemical reactions may occur, causing damage to the aluminum layer and affecting the performance of the aluminized film.

• Primer-coated aluminized film: The primer can provide a protective barrier for the aluminum layer, enhance the chemical resistance of the aluminized film, and make it more stable in different chemical environments.

Cost

• Ordinary aluminized film: The production process is relatively simple, no additional primer step is required, and the cost is low.

• Primer-coated aluminized film: The process and material cost of primer coating are increased, and its price is usually higher than that of ordinary aluminized film.

There are the following differences in the application of ordinary aluminized film and primer-coated aluminized film:

Packaging field

• Ordinary aluminized film: It is often used for ordinary product packaging that does not require high barrier properties and appearance, and does not require subsequent complex processing, such as some cheap food inner packaging, small hardware packaging, etc.

• Primer-coated aluminized film: It is widely used in product packaging that requires high packaging appearance, printing effect and product shelf life, such as packaging of high-end food, medicine, cosmetics, etc. For example, chocolate packaging, primer-coated aluminized film can make the packaging printing exquisite, and can well block external water vapor and oxygen, extending the shelf life of chocolate.

Printing field

• Ordinary aluminized film: It is rarely used directly for high-precision, high-quality printing products, and is generally used in simple warning signs, temporary labels and other fields with low requirements for printing quality.

• Primer-coated aluminized film: It is the first choice for the printing industry. It can be used to make exquisite posters, brochures, high-end gift boxes, etc. It can present clear, bright and firm printed patterns and meet various complex design and printing process requirements.

Composite field

• Ordinary aluminized film: It is used in some simple composite materials with low composite strength requirements, such as composite with ordinary plastic film for some general moisture-proof and light-shielding products.

• Primer-coated aluminized film: It is widely used in fields with high composite fastness requirements, such as composite with paper to make high-end cardboard, and composite with plastic film to produce various high-performance packaging materials, which can ensure that the composite layer will not easily separate during subsequent processing and use.

Electronic field

• Ordinary aluminized film: It can be used for simple packaging or auxiliary shielding of some electronic products with low electromagnetic shielding requirements and cost sensitivity.

• Primer-coated aluminized film: It is more widely used in electromagnetic shielding, insulation and other aspects of electronic equipment. Due to its good adhesion and stability, it can maintain performance in long-term use and ensure the normal operation and safety of electronic equipment.
